MenuAs an EdTech enthusiast, you’re likely aware that some student groups and academic areas need more attention:
Upskilling and Reskilling: With technology advancing so quickly, there's a huge demand for continuous learning to keep skills fresh and relevant.
Personalized Learning: Using AI to tailor education to individual students can help cater to different learning styles and improve engagement.
Interactive Learning: Incorporating VR and AR can make learning more hands-on and engaging, especially for subjects like science and engineering.
Bite-Sized Learning: Creating short, easily digestible learning modules is great for busy professionals who need to fit learning into their hectic schedules.
Hybrid Learning Models: Combining online and in-person learning offers flexibility and can cater to different learning preferences.
Accessibility: Ensuring educational resources are accessible to all students, including those with disabilities, is crucial.
Mental Health Support: Integrating mental health resources into educational platforms can help students manage stress and overall well-being.
Global Reach: Expanding access to quality education in underserved regions can make a huge impact.
